Sebastian Barnes
The former Ghana U-17 captain returns to the local scene after leaving the country in 1995 to join Bayer Leverkusen.
This was after he had skippered the Black Starlets to win the 1991 FIFA U-17 World Cup in Italy.
Barnes has previously managed the U-17 side of Bayer Leverkusen and is a UEFA License B holder.
The 46-year-old played for German sides Leverkusen, FSV Mainz 05, VfL Hamm/Sieg and American side Orlando Sundogs.
He will work under a yet-to-be-named Head Coach and newly appointed Technical Director Rene Hiddink.
